A two-sided marketplace in the cryptocurrency world connects two distinct groups: buyers and sellers. These platforms act as intermediaries, allowing users to trade digital assets in a secure and transparent environment. Below are some notable examples of such platforms in the cryptocurrency space.

1. Decentralized Exchanges (DEX)

Decentralized exchanges (DEX) are a prime example of a two-sided marketplace in the crypto world. These platforms allow users to directly trade digital currencies without the need for a central authority. Here, both traders (buyers and sellers) interact with each other in a peer-to-peer manner.

  • Uniswap - A decentralized platform that uses automated market makers to facilitate trades.
  • 1inch - An aggregator DEX that compares prices across multiple decentralized exchanges to offer the best rates.

"DEX platforms offer greater privacy and security compared to centralized exchanges because they do not require personal information or deposits to be held by a third party."

2. Peer-to-Peer (P2P) Platforms

Peer-to-peer (P2P) platforms provide a direct connection between buyers and sellers. These platforms often facilitate crypto transactions using fiat currency, enabling users from various geographical locations to trade securely and efficiently.

  1. LocalBitcoins - One of the largest and most established P2P platforms for buying and selling Bitcoin.
  2. Paxful - A global P2P marketplace that offers more than 300 payment methods for users to choose from.

How Airbnb Facilitates Connections Between Hosts and Travelers

Airbnb operates as a two-sided marketplace, bringing together individuals offering accommodations with travelers seeking a place to stay. The platform allows hosts to list their properties, while guests can browse and select the most suitable options based on location, price, and other preferences. This creates a seamless ecosystem where both parties benefit from the shared economy. The success of Airbnb lies in its ability to facilitate these connections effectively, leveraging technology to simplify transactions and enhance user experience.

To understand how Airbnb connects hosts and guests, it's essential to look at the key elements that make this interaction possible. These elements include property listings, reviews, pricing models, and communication tools. The platform's core business model is designed to promote trust, transparency, and convenience, enabling both hosts and guests to find value in the transaction.

Key Elements of the Airbnb Marketplace

  • Host Listings: Hosts create detailed listings with information about their property, including photos, descriptions, pricing, and availability.
  • Guest Search: Guests search for available properties based on filters such as location, price range, and amenities.
  • Reviews: Both hosts and guests can leave reviews, creating a feedback loop that encourages quality service and builds trust.
  • Secure Payment System: Airbnb handles all financial transactions, ensuring that payments are processed safely and on time.

Steps in the Airbnb Process

  1. Host Creates a Listing: A property owner provides detailed information and uploads photos.
  2. Guest Searches for Accommodation: A guest uses filters to find the perfect match based on their preferences.
  3. Booking Confirmation: Once the guest selects a property, the booking is confirmed, and payment is made securely.
  4. Guest Review: After the stay, the guest leaves feedback, and the host does the same.

How Uber Balances Supply and Demand Between Drivers and Riders

Uber operates in a two-sided marketplace where supply and demand are dynamically adjusted between drivers and riders. This balance is crucial for ensuring both parties have a positive experience. On the supply side, Uber must ensure that there are enough drivers on the road to meet demand at various times of the day, while on the demand side, the company works to ensure riders have access to a reliable and efficient transportation service. Uber employs various strategies to balance this relationship, particularly through its dynamic pricing model and real-time demand predictions.

To achieve this equilibrium, Uber uses sophisticated algorithms that take into account factors like location, time of day, and rider behavior. The platform constantly analyzes demand surges in specific areas and adjusts supply accordingly by notifying nearby drivers of potential ride requests. Additionally, Uber provides incentives such as surge pricing to encourage more drivers to become available during peak demand periods.

Strategies for Managing the Marketplace

  • Dynamic Pricing: Uber adjusts fares based on demand in real-time, encouraging more drivers to become active during high-demand times.
  • Driver Incentives: The platform offers bonuses or surge pricing to drivers during periods of high demand, ensuring availability.
  • Real-time Data: Uber uses predictive algorithms to forecast demand patterns and guide drivers to high-demand areas.
  • Geographical Adjustments: Drivers are encouraged to position themselves in areas where demand is expected to surge, based on predictive models.

Challenges in Managing Network Effects in a 2-Sided Marketplace: A Look at TaskRabbit

The management of network effects in a two-sided marketplace presents unique challenges, especially in a platform like TaskRabbit, where both taskers (service providers) and clients (task requesters) interact. Ensuring the equilibrium between supply and demand is critical for the platform's success. A core issue arises from the fact that a greater number of users on one side of the marketplace can drive up the value for users on the other side. However, without a balanced user growth, the platform risks either an oversupply or undersupply of services, resulting in a poor experience for both parties.

In the context of TaskRabbit, managing this balance becomes even more complex due to the variability in demand for services and the geographical spread of users. Ensuring that there are enough taskers available in various locations to meet user demand, without overwhelming certain markets, is a constant challenge. This issue is amplified in the cryptocurrency and blockchain ecosystems, where platforms might deal with fluctuating transaction volumes and the unpredictability of decentralized economies.

Key Factors Influencing Network Effects at TaskRabbit

  • Supply and Demand Fluctuations: Rapid changes in demand, especially in local markets, can result in taskers either over or under-supplying services, which negatively impacts the user experience.
  • Geographic Distribution of Users: With taskers and clients located in various regions, maintaining balance in service availability across these regions can be difficult, especially in areas with lower task volume.
  • Task Quality and Reputation: As taskers are rated by clients, maintaining high-quality service and positive reviews is essential for attracting future clients, but the need for consistent demand can challenge service quality standards.
